Java图书管理系统项目建立
随着数字化时代的到来,图书管理已经成为了一个越来越重要的领域。为了更好地管理图书馆的图书,我们需要一个高效的图书管理系统。本文将介绍我们开发的Java图书管理系统,它是一款基于Java语言的图书管理应用程序,能够帮助图书馆管理人员快速高效地管理图书。
项目概述
我们的Java图书管理系统是一个基于Java语言的图书管理应用程序,它包括以下功能:
1. 图书添加/删除/修改/查询功能;
2. 读者管理功能,包括读者的基本信息、借阅和归还记录等;
3. 借阅管理功能,包括图书借阅、续借、还书等;
4. 系统管理功能,包括管理员的基本信息、权限管理、系统设置等。
系统架构
我们的Java图书管理系统采用了前后端分离的架构模式。前端使用了React框架,构建了一个用户友好的界面,用户可以通过界面进行图书添加、删除、修改、查询等操作。后端使用了Java语言,使用Spring框架构建了一个RESTful API,用于与前端进行通信,实现图书添加、删除、修改、查询等操作。
数据库设计
我们的Java图书管理系统使用了MySQL数据库进行数据存储。数据库包含了图书、读者、借阅等信息的表。每个表都包含了相关的字段,如图书ID、作者、出版社、ISBN号、分类、定价、库存量等。通过数据库的设计,我们能够高效地存储和管理图书、读者、借阅等信息。
系统实现
我们的Java图书管理系统实现了以下主要的功能:
1. 用户登录功能;
2. 图书添加、删除、修改、查询功能;
3. 读者管理功能,包括读者的基本信息、借阅和归还记录等;
4. 借阅管理功能,包括图书借阅、续借、还书等;
5. 系统管理功能,包括管理员的基本信息、权限管理、系统设置等。
系统测试
我们的Java图书管理系统经过了严格的测试,包括功能测试、性能测试、安全测试等。测试过程中,我们使用了各种工具和方法,如JMeter、压力测试、日志分析等。通过测试,我们保证了系统的稳定性和可靠性,并且发现并解决了一些潜在的问题。
总结
我们的Java图书管理系统是一款高效、稳定、可靠的图书管理应用程序。通过该系统,图书馆管理人员能够高效地管理图书,提高图书管理的效率。该系统还具有良好的安全性和可扩展性,能够满足未来的需求。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。